
Whether spoken, written, signed, or thought, language is part of everything we do. How often do we reflect on the role of language in God’s kingdom? The world’s 7,000 languages are not merely obstacles to be overcome; they are part of God’s beautiful plan.
Language in the Mission of God will deepen your understanding of the role of language in your faith and practice. Through 22 contributing authors from around the globe, this collection of writings will challenge Christian leaders to engage in ministry across linguistic and cultural boundaries.
